I sometimes like SNL. The writers are usually pretty apt. Pete Davidson is only funny when there's good writing. He is not good enough to be the thing that makes something worth your time. And worth your time, this movie definitely is not. There was a great family movie right in front of them, and they didn't go with it.
Poorly animated, badly scripted, not entertaining or funny (a waste of an SNL cast member) and senseless storyline. This was supposed to be released in 2019, and because of COVID it wasn't. It appears that nobody touched it these three additional years for ANY improvements to the editing, writing or animating. Not worth the time unless you are playing it for a 4 year old, and even THEY might not watch it!

There are some movies that are so bad, they're good. This is not one of those movies. The fact that Pete Davidson (whose work I generally enjoy) and JK Simmons (whose work I generally love) star in this film is absurd. I wonder if either of them had read the script before showing up to record.
The animation is subpar (the body proportions are creepily . . . Off), the voice acting is rough (sounds like reading the script), and the mouths regularly don't match with the voices. I honestly hope to never watch this movie again.
